2018 has come and gone, but my splurges live on! I don’t think I need to tell you that I did my fair share of shopping last year. However, I really tried to invest in some great pieces to last me forever. As I try to change my buying habits for 2019 (aka investing in quality as opposed to quantity), I’m reminding myself about the great pieces I purchased and why they were used time and time again. Read about my favorites below that are all still available and need to be in your home!
– Any and all Lele Sadoughi headbands: 2018 was the year of the headband for me. I found my new obsession! I’ve purchased many headbands from different brands, but the Lele Sadoughi headbands are my favorite. As someone who suffers from migraines, they are comfy and don’t cause headaches. A huge perk!
– West Elm Dinner Plates: I have been preparing to move out of my parent’s house so I invested in a new set of plates from West Elm. I love the clean, sleek style and you can tell they are great quality.
– Tory Burch Clara Mule: Surprisingly, this was my first pair of Tory Burch shoes! I am not the biggest fan of pointy-toed shoes, but I love these! They are so comfy that I ended up buying them in black and tried out another pair that impressed, as well. I honestly was shocked with the quality and they are adorable!
– Old Navy Shirt Dress: Old Navy is one of my favorite places to shop for casual clothing. This dress was on repeat all summer because it is very comfy and a great lightweight fabric for those long humid days in Charleston. Plus, it’s currently under $30!
– Mario Badescu Products: I have been raving about these products all over my blog. I don’t use many beauty products, but I do use Mario Badescu’s Whitening Mask, Drying Lotion, and Drying Cream in my weekly routine. I have definitely seen a difference since I started using these.
– A longer phone charger: Does it make me lazy having this on the list?! This was a great purchase this year for all the traveling I’ve been doing. Plugs aren’t always in the most convenient spots, which makes this item super useful!
